  • This dataset contains the raw data from GNSS/INS (Global Navigation Satellite System/Inertial Navigation System) buoys deployed during the 2019-2020 MOSAiC expedition. These buoys recorded the data from GNSS and Sensors. The raw GNSS data contain time, latitude, longitude, velocity, and fix type. The raw Sensors data contain time, acceleration, gyroscope, magnetometer, and temperature. These data were sampled at 10 Hz. The original data was in ANPP format (see advancednavigation.com), which have been converted to structured ASCII formats (such as RINEX, CSV) using Spatial Manager software. The buoys were assembled by the University of Huddersfield team and the deployment was done by the MOSAiC ice team throughout the expedition.   • These datasets show how lake water-pressure fluctuated through time over several months in seasonally-frozen catchments in winter. These catchments were in three settings: the lowland Finnish Arctic, an alpine valley and a high cirque in Switzerland. The water-pressure data are accompanied by water temperature and (except for Orajarvi), ground temperature for the same periods. Together, they were used to detect and quantify the water content of snow falling on the lake surfaces. The locations, method of data collection and analysis and the results are described in detail in Pritchard, H. D., Farinotti, D., & Colwell, S. (2021).
